US Fabrics is the exclusive distributor in the United States and Canada for DuPont™ SF spunbonded, nonwoven geotextiles. Dupont SF40 spunbond is the preferred geotextile for use in the manufacturing of wick drains, also known as prefabricated vertical drains (PVD's). 

Dupont's patented spunbond production technique delivers the unique properties and uniform quality that make them the perfect choice for companies manufacturing wick drains. Ounce for ounce, spunbond geotextiles deliver more tensile strength and tear strength than needle-punched nonwovens. Spunbond geotextiles outperform needle-punch nonwovens in resisting installation damage, resulting in a longer service life.

Prefabricated vertical drains (PVD's) are one method used to accelerate the consolidation of soft, compressible soils. They are manufactured from a flexible, polypropylene core with drainage grooves or channels. The core is wrapped in a spunbonded, geotextile filter fabric such as DuPont SF40. They are then installed vertically into the soil with the use of a specialized machine called a stitcher. The PVD is installed with a backhoe or crane with an attached vertical mast housing with a mandrel holding the wick drain. The mandrel hydraulically pushes or vibrates the wick drain into the ground and then is withdrawn back into the mast, leaving the wick drain in place.
